Lee Jae-myung, the Democratic Party of Korea's presidential candidate, held his final local rally in front of a crowd of 3,500 citizens and supporters (according to police estimates) in front of Busan Station on the 1st. Lee held a placard with commitments such as “Ministry of Oceans and Fisheries transfer,” “HMM attraction,” and “Southeast Investment Bank establishment.” Standing on either side of Lee were members of the Democratic Party’s election strategy committee holding placards with the phrase “A wave in Busan” written one character at a time.
After finishing the photo session, Lee began his speech, saying, “When I looked at the placard, I realized something was missing,” and pledged to bring the maritime court to Busan as well. He added, “People say it should be in Incheon, why in Busan? If the maritime logistics industry develops, there will be many cases. Can one court cover it all?”
Lee Jae-myung poured all efforts into ‘PK’ (Busan, Ulsan, and Gyeongnam), which he selected as his last local rally spot. The rally in front of Busan Station was supported by Kim Kyeong-soo, the general election strategy chairman, Jeong Eun-gyeong, the general election strategy chairman, Han Chang-min, the joint election strategy chairman, lawmaker Jeon Jae-soo, former National Security Office second vice chief Kim Hyun-jong, and Kim Du-gwan, the local decentralization and innovation committee chairman. Father Song Gi-in, known as a mentor to former presidents Roh Moo-hyun and Moon Jae-in, also visited the rally site.
In his speech, Lee emphasized making Busan a base for a maritime power in the era of the Arctic sea route. He promised to fulfill the transfer of the Ministry of Oceans and Fisheries and HMM as provincial commitments. Particularly in the case of HMM transfer, he emphasized completing the headquarters transfer even if there are workers who continue to oppose it. Regarding the Southeast Investment Bank (tentative name) announced that morning as a pledge, he appraised it as a more realistic plan compared to the transfer of the Korea Development Bank.
Lee Jae-myung said, “They say Lee Jae-myung has a high fulfillment rate of commitments, but it's not because of some extraordinary superhuman ability. It’s just that what can be fulfilled, is done by any means necessary, despite government hindrances. That’s why the rate is high,” and added, “I will create a national policy bank so that the Southeast Investment Bank can support the maritime logistics industry and its supporting industries.”
During the rally in Ulsan, attended by 4,000 citizens and supporters (according to police estimates), a “union court establishment” was mentioned. Lee noted, “Assembly member Kim Tae-sun, head of the execution department, said if a labor court is to be created, it should be established in Ulsan first, as it’s a city of workers,” and added, “I haven’t responded yet. Isn’t the main reason for politics to ensure everyone lives well and prospers?”
He also strongly urged voters not to vote for Kim Moon-soo, the People Power Party's presidential candidate. He emphasized, “If puppet of Jeon Kwang-hoon and avatar of Yoon Suk-yeol, Kim Moon-soo, returns, it means the coup leader Yoon Suk-yeol will come back as the supreme king, continuing the era of rebellion,” and added, “We absolutely cannot forgive or accept this. We must prove by voting that this country is a democratic republic.”
